Recent studies showed that bladder storage symptoms are predominant among MS with a pooled prevalence of frequency at 73.45% followed by urgency at 63.87%. Transcutaneous tibial nerve stimulation (TTNS) is a non-invasive treatment to manage bladder storage symptoms; however, the effectiveness of TTNS is based on a small number of studies with the absence of high-quality evidence. This study aims to investigate the effectiveness of TTNS on bladder storage symptoms compared with sham TTNS among people with MS.Methods: The investigators will use a randomised sham controlled double blind study to explore the effectiveness of TTNS in the treatment of bladder storage symptoms in MS. the Standard Protocol Items: Recommendations for Interventional Trials (SPIRIT) was followed to standardize the conduct and reporting of the current protocol. The recruitment plan is twofold: 1) Open recruitment for people with MS through King Fahd Hospital of the University communication channels; 2) people with any type of MS attending their routine appointments in MS clinic at King Fahd Hospital of the University, Al Khobar. The investigators will investigate the effectiveness of TTNS compared to sham TTNS on bladder storage symptoms and the effect on quality of life using ICIQ-OAB, ICIQ 3-day bladder diary, ICIQ-LUTS qol, and PSQI. Participant's perception of change post intervention will be evaluated using GPE. Outcomes will be measured at 0, 6 weeks and at 6 months post intervention. Yet, both are underdiagnosed and undertreated with significant financial and health-related consequences. OAB syndrome is characterized by urinary urgency, with and without urinary incontinence, urinary frequency, and nocturia. Evidence-based treatments are available, including behavioral therapy, pharmacotherapy, and minimally invasive procedures. Diagnosis and treatment are also associated with improvement in urinary symptoms and overall quality of life (QOL).3 However, 70-80% of treated patients will discontinue use of therapy in the first year due to one of several factors (e.g., cost, tolerability, inadequate effect). In addition, only 4.7% progress to advanced therapies suggesting undertreatment for those that need it most. Vulnerable populations are especially at risk, as therapy utilization are lowest among older, lower income, and\u002For minority groups. Poor access, insufficient patient education regarding disease chronicity, expected outcomes, costs, and potential side effects lead to unrealistic patient perceptions about therapy. This leads to suboptimal therapy duration, poor treatment efficacy, adherence, and undertreatment. Overactive bladder affects approximately 13% of older women and thus represents a condition with high prevalence. Affected women report significant limitations in daily life, as well as social isolation. Despite the high occurrence of this condition, therapeutic options are limited, partly because the etiology of this condition is not fully understood. Increasingly, studies suggest an imbalance in the urogenital microbiome as a possible cause of the development of the condition. Many people with overactive bladder improve with lifestyle changes and medicines. However, some patients do not respond to these standard treatments and continue to suffer from bothersome symptoms. This study is designed to help patients who have not improved with available medical therapy.\n\nTwo treatments will be compared in this research. The first treatment uses platelet-rich plasma. Platelet-rich plasma is made from a patient's own blood and contains growth factors that may help repair the lining of the bladder and improve bladder function. The second treatment uses botulinum toxin. Botulinum toxin is a protein that can reduce unwanted bladder contractions and is already approved for use in patients with overactive bladder who did not respond to other treatments.\n\nThe purpose of this study is to evaluate whether platelet-rich plasma injection into the bladder wall is safe, effective, and durable when compared with botulinum toxin injection into the bladder muscle. We believe that platelet-rich plasma may improve bladder health by encouraging tissue repair and reducing inflammation, while botulinum toxin may reduce bladder overactivity by blocking chemical signals that cause muscle contractions.\n\nThis study will take place at Benha University Hospital in Egypt.
